08 Jun Ukraine’s drones active over part of Russian-occupied Crimea
London, (Oilandgaspress) – Drone operators from Ukraine’s 3rd Special Operations Forces Regiment have taken aerial control of part of Russia’s land supply route to occupied Crimea, the military reported on June 6.
According to the statement, Ukrainian drones are capable of targeting Russian equipment and logistics along the Melitopol — Chonhar route in Ukraine’s south, which leads to Crimea, occupied by Russia since 2014.
The regiment said this has complicated Russian military supply and fuel logistics to Crimea. In recent weeks, the peninsula has continued to experience fuel shortages stemming from a combination of Ukrainian strikes on supply routes as well as on oil infrastructure.
“This is just the beginning. More to come,” the Ukrainian military said, releasing a video purportedly showing drone strikes.
